Retour au blog

Comment sauvegarder des réponses Stack Overflow en Markdown

·
#stackoverflow#development#coding#programming

Stack Overflow est la ressource de référence de tout développeur pour les solutions de code. Mais sauvegarder les réponses pour une référence hors ligne ou une documentation personnelle a toujours été laborieux — les blocs de code se déforment, le formatage se casse, et le contexte se perd. Voici comment sauvegarder correctement le contenu Stack Overflow.

Pourquoi sauvegarder Stack Overflow en Markdown ?

Les développeurs ont besoin du contenu Stack Overflow en dehors du navigateur :

  • Accès hors ligne — coder sans internet
  • Documentation personnelle — construire des bases de connaissances
  • Wikis d’équipe — partager des solutions en interne
  • Extraits de code — sauvegarder des solutions fonctionnelles
  • Préparation aux entretiens — étudier les problèmes courants

Markdown est le format idéal pour le contenu technique.

Ce que Save capture sur Stack Overflow

Questions

  • Texte complet de la question avec formatage
  • Blocs de code avec coloration syntaxique préservée
  • Tags et métadonnées
  • Nombre de votes

Réponses

  • Contenu complet de la réponse
  • Tous les blocs de code correctement formatés
  • Commentaires pertinents
  • Indicateur de réponse acceptée

Exemple de sortie

# Comment vérifier si une liste est vide en Python ?

**Tags :** python, list, empty
**Votes :** 4 521 | **Réponses :** 12
**Posée :** il y a 8 ans

## Question

J'ai une liste en Python :

\`\`\`python
my_list = []
\`\`\`

Quelle est la façon la plus Pythonique de vérifier si elle est vide ?

---

## Réponse acceptée ✓

**Votes :** 5 892

La façon la plus Pythonique est d'utiliser la valeur booléenne implicite
de la liste :

\`\`\`python
if not my_list:
    print("La liste est vide")
\`\`\`

Les listes vides s'évaluent à `False` dans un contexte booléen.
C'est plus propre que de vérifier `len(my_list) == 0`.

Cas d’utilisation

Construire une documentation personnelle

  • Sauvegarder les solutions aux problèmes résolus
  • Créer des guides de référence rapide
  • Construire des bibliothèques de dépannage

Bases de connaissances d’équipe

  • Documenter les problèmes courants et leurs solutions
  • Créer des supports d’intégration
  • Construire un Stack Overflow interne

Préparation aux entretiens

  • Étudier les questions d’algorithmes courants
  • Sauvegarder des solutions bien expliquées
  • Construire des supports de révision

Développement hors ligne

  • Sauvegarder les solutions critiques pour le travail hors ligne
  • Créer des docs de référence portables
  • Travailler dans des environnements sans internet

Assistance au développement par IA

Donnez Stack Overflow aux assistants IA pour :

  • Expliquer des solutions complexes
  • Adapter les réponses à votre cas spécifique
  • Comparer différentes approches
  • Déboguer des problèmes connexes

Conseils pour de meilleurs résultats

  1. Développez toutes les réponses — cliquez sur « Afficher X autres réponses »
  2. Incluez les commentaires — contiennent souvent un contexte important
  3. Fonctionne sur tout Stack Exchange — ServerFault, SuperUser, etc.

Gestion des blocs de code

Save préserve les blocs de code avec :

  • Indentation correcte
  • Tags de langue pour la coloration syntaxique
  • Code inline avec backticks
  • Blocs multi-lignes avec triple backticks

Commencer

Installez Save depuis le Chrome Web Store — boostez votre workflow de développement.


Des questions ? Contactez-nous à [email protected]